Great Lakes Workforce Quality Initiative

Overview

The Great Lakes Governors want to ensure that emerging, existing, and transitional workers in their states have the skills necessary to compete and thrive in today’s economic marketplace, while maintaining the region’s competitive edge. In July 1997, as part of the Workforce Quality Initiative, they announced the creation of the Great Lakes Guarantee, a portable, regional endorsement of state or national industry skill standards. New metalworking skills developed by the National Institute for Metalworking Skills (NIMS) were the first skills recognized under the Guarantee.
